svn - SVN中的并行路径覆盖彼此的文件

标签 svn tortoisesvn

我有两条路,比方说:

根\文件夹1 根\文件夹2

虽然文件夹名称不同,但都包含具有相同名称的文件,只是部分内容不同。我已将所有路径及其所有文件添加到 SVN 中。现在,我对 root\folder1\fileA 进行更改并提交。如果我尝试更改 root\folder2\fileA,则会收到错误消息,指出我需要先更新。当我进行更新时,我的本地副本将被我刚刚对 root\folder1 下的 fileA 所做的更改覆盖。反之亦然。

我不知道为什么会发生这种情况。我什至删除了 root\folder2 并重新创建它并将其重新添加到 SVN。但同样的事情仍在发生......

最佳答案

听起来folder1和folder2是同一存储库目录的两个工作副本。如果您检查folder1和folder2的svn信息(或tortoisesvn中的等效信息),那么应该 提供有关正在发生的事情的线索。

关于svn - SVN中的并行路径覆盖彼此的文件,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/4492885/

相关文章:

svn - 需要 TortoiseMerge 的稳定替代品来应用补丁

tortoisesvn - 在 Tortoise SVN 中导出选定的修订差异(需要新旧文件)

Windows Server 2003 上的 Git 或 svn

SVN - 审查特定人员所做的更改

git - 创建远程 Git 分支作为 SVN 存储库的特定 git-svn 分支的镜像

tortoisesvn - TortoiseProc 如何从命令行区分修订版本之间的文件

svn - TortoiseSVN(迁移到新存储库)

SVN:无法在单个文件上设置 svn ignore

svn - VisualSVN服务器: post-commit hook failed. SVN : Unable to make name for 'D:\websites\mywebsite. com\tempfile

svn - 乌龟SVN : Reverting